Usually, these terms are used by meteorologists and weather presenters when they provide an update on the forecast. if it is brisk, the weather is fairly cold and a fairly strong wind is blowing, if the weather or the sea is wild, there is a storm with strong winds, unsettled weather changes a lot during a short period and there is a lot of wind and rain, if the weather is fresh, it is fairly cold and the wind is blowing, if the weather is squally, there are short periods when the wind is suddenly very strong, Britishmainly spoken with strong winds blowing, used for talking about weather that is fairly cold and windy, the sharpness of a blade or of a cold wind, the fact that the wind or frost is very cold.
